They look great Gazcw imho, it's called shadow chrome/silver. Basically black all over with the face of each wheel then blown over with the silver effect. Works well on deep rims and really makes the calipers stand out. I added the red pin lines after as I had a completely sterile surface to work with. Halfords red pinstripe, a hairdryer to warm everything up to keep it sticky and voila. I've done the hubs black as well for that discrete look.
